Abstract

An apparatus for security printing of a document on a substrate, having a first and second side, comprising: PA1 i) means for feeding variable data in a predetermined digital format to printing stations, PA1 ii) at least two printing stations, for image-wise depositing, in accordance to the predetermined format of the variable data, toner particles on the substrate, PA1 iii) means for fusing the toner particles to the substrate, to form a fused toner image, characterized in that PA2 a) the apparatus comprises means for introducing security features in the document and PA2 b) the means for fusing the toner particles to the substrate comprise means for heating and melting the toner particles such that between the melting toner particles and the substrate a contact angle of at most 90.degree. is formed and leave at most 25 mg/m.sup.2 of an external releasing agent on the fused toner image.
